Re: Looking for descendants of Joan Theodor Lambertus BIXSCHLAG

Lothar, there is this information on a family of four taken from the Index of Passengers Lists of Ships Arriving from Foreign Ports at the Port of New Orleans, Louisiana. Date of arrival is December 2, 1851:

-- Johan BIXSCHLAG; age 29; Farmer; Port of Departure – Breman, Germany; destination St. Louis, MO; ship name Milan.
-- Gertrud BIXSCHLAG; age 30; Port of Departure – Breman, Germany; destination St. Louis, MO; ship name Milan.
-- Anna BIXSCHLAG; age 4 months.
-- Gerad BIXSCHLAG; age 4 months.

Johan and Gertrud could not be found in any US censuses. However, in the 1920 Census for Justice Precinct #2, Parker County, Texas, Enumeration District 66, Worth Street, Sheet 6A, taken January 9, 1920 is this entry for their son:

Bixschlag, J. G., head, white male, age 68, single, arrived in US 1851, naturalized 1861, born Germany, parents born Germany, occupation farm laborer.
